Tectual Tech Services
Category: Epabx Dealers
Contact Number: +(91)-11-26343404
Address: 6,, Nr. Thapar Chamber 2, Kirlokri, Delhi - 110014
Category: Epabx Dealers
Contact Number: +(91)-11-26343404
Address: 6,, Nr. Thapar Chamber 2, Kirlokri, Delhi - 110014